Hill Freedman World Academy was the 19-6 winner over Bodine when they last played one another back in April of 2021, but their luck changed this time around. Hill Freedman World Academy lost 12-1 to Bodine on Thursday. The match marked Hill Freedman World Academy's lowest-scoring game so far this season.
Hill Freedman World Academy's loss was their seventh straight at home d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 2-3. As for Bodine, the win keeps they at an undefeated 6-0.
Hill Freedman World Academy will have a little extra prep time after the defeat as they won't be playing again for a while. They'll take on Murrell Dobbins Vo-Tech at 3:15 p.m. on the 23rd. As for Bodine, they will square off against Saul at 3:15 p.m. on Friday. Bodine will need to watch out since the Razorbacks have now posted at least ten runs in their last four contests.
